Princeton's WordNet0.0 / 0 votes

  1. correctly, right, arightadverb

    in an accurate manner

    "the flower had been correctly depicted by his son"; "he guessed right"

    Synonyms:
    in good order, the right way, powerful, decently, justly, flop, properly, right on, mightily, right, mighty, aright, decent

    Antonyms:
    wrongly, incorrectly, wrong
